Mixed berry prices to rise on tight volume

Blueberry, raspberry, and blackberry supplies are tightening, which will likely cause prices to rise over the next few weeks.
According to an alert to buyers from Markon Cooperative BB #:123315 on February 15, mixed berry supplies are becoming harder to find, and blueberry volume will remain the most challenged over the next two weeks.
Markon’s report said:
Blueberries
- Mexican volume has dipped; supplies will increase in late February when spring production moves into full swing
- Import shipments from Chile and Peru are experiencing vessel delays and unloading challenges
- Texas-grown supplies are tight
- Stocks will be extremely limited this week and next; expect volume to rise the week of February 28
Blackberries
- Mexican production is past its peak; supplies are tightening
- Texas-grown supplies are limited
- Markets are inching up
- Quality remains strong
Raspberries
- Mexican supplies are tighter this week
- Texas-grown supplies are scarce
- Markets are firming
- Quality is very good
As of February 16, USDA hadn’t recorded higher prices yet.
